Leia smiled at the young Jedi in front of her. She had all of the characteristics of a warrior. A dream, a goal, the ability to achieve them, a highly dangerous weapon and a heart of gold. The perfect characteristics to help the Resistance. The young Jedi smiled a bit as ye two stared out into the blackness of space.
"We're entering hyper space," Poe Dameron yelled from the cockpit of the Falcon.
"The sooner we get out of Crait's system the better," Rey muttered to herself.
Leia chuckled. "I found out about the Resistance my father was leading all those years ago during a humanity mission to Crait." Leia closed her eyes and thought about the time before the First Order. "My father, Bail Oragana and my mother, Breha Oragana led the Resistance behind my back until I found out on Crait." Leia noted that Rey was listing intently so she continued. "I was hooked. The empire had no mercy and as a young diplomat and a princess I found it my duty to help the cause against the Empire and Palpatine."
"That was very brave of you," Rey said quietly.
"Well, you are very brave to standing up for my son." Rey gave a uncomfortable look and stared down at the steel floor. "It's okay, I know what went on in the throne room."
"How? You weren't there, were you?"
Leia smiled softly. "I could feel it through the force. You both fought side by side and you crossed the galaxy to fight him."
"General I swear I know what your thinking-"
"Snoke is dead."
Rey nodded. "Kylo killed him."
"Not Kylo, Ben." Leia smiled, her blue eyes sparkled. "My son is on the road to redemption, thanks to you."
Advertisement
Rey blushed and took a look out of the window. "General, he is the supreme leader now. What are we supposed to do?"
"You know what you need to do."
"I do?"
"You need to trust your instincts. That's how you ended up here. You didn't give BB-8 to Unkar Plutt and you chose the Falcon as your escape ship on Jakku."
"Technically the other ship got blown up-"
"Not the point. Remember your ancestors and remember Ben. He cares for you. I feel him torn. Fix him, Rey. Give him what I never could," Leia said staring sadly out of the window.
"General," Rey said crestfallen. "I'm sorry I couldn't bring him back."
Leia embraced the Jedi and smiled softly. "Ben will come home when he is ready, now you have a lightsaber to fix and I have to make sure that Poe doesn't ram the Falcon into the nearest First Order ship."
With that Leia stood up, smiled, and went back into a small room in the back of the Falcon. A little kitchenette, a table and chairs, a bed and various toys were strewn about. She smiled Remembering how Han built this for her.
"What do you think about the girl?"
"I think Ben is in good hands," Leia said smiling as she picked up a stuffed Ewok, the name Ben scribbled on it's stomach.
"I miss my boy," Leia said tearing a bit. "I pray to the maker that he will stay safe." Han nodded and smiled.
"At least we can rest assured that someone will always love him," he said softly. "Rey is truly special."
"Indeed, I'm glad that Ben found her."
"Me too. Tell Chewie I said hi and Leia?"
"Yes?"
"I-I love you," Han said before disappearing.
Leia sat in the chair and dazed off, remembering all of the nights that the three would stay here and be a family. Smiling to herself she began to think of all of the new memories Ben and Rey could have here with their family.
"Soon," Leia said smiling to herself, still clutching Ben's childhood toys.
